Company Overview
OLIZ LTD is a London-based hospitality and lifestyle brand operator with growing concepts across the city. Our flagship brands include:
- Fatchoy Canteen – modern Asian takeaway concept
- Foofoo 幸福饭包 – Taiwanese lunchbox concept (launching soon)
- Guangda Kiln – ceramic & tea collection in collaboration with a historic Taiwanese studio
As we expand our operations and prepare to scale across locations and product lines, we are looking for a full-time Operations & Strategy Coordinator to join our HQ team and help streamline systems, data, and compliance across the company.
Key Responsibilities
- Oversee and manage day-to-day procurement and supplier coordination, working directly with store managers and kitchen teams
- Track, analyse, and report on weekly revenue, cost of goods, customer reviews, and operational KPIs
- Lead the documentation and review of SOPs, internal processes, and compliance records, including Right to Work audits and staff checklists
- Conduct regular site visits and generate detailed hygiene, quality, and staff performance reports
- Collaborate with the Director and Creative Lead on expansion planning, franchise documentation, and partnership research
- Liaise with external parties including digital platforms, landlord/property agents, and design/branding vendors
